Polish law enforcement agencies have been taken into custody by the suspected acts of vandalism of Ukrainians for a term of three months,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Ukraine reports.

“According to preliminary information of the Consulate General of Ukraine in Wroclaw, suspected of vandalism was taken into custody for three months. The consular official is in contact with local law enforcement agencies, and a request was sent to find out the circumstances of the event, ”the department said.

The Foreign Ministry added that the case is under the control of the consular institution.

The day before, Polish law enforcement officers detained a 17-year-old citizen of Ukraine, who probably committed a sabotage to the Russian intelligence services.

Commenting on his detention, the Embassy of Ukraine condemned “any shameful actions against places of memory” and regarded them as a provocation of Russian special services.

Also the other day in Poland, teenagers suspected of being suspected of a monument of the Volyn tragedy and other provocations at the request of Russian special services were detained.
